Delta Electronics, Inc., together with its subsidiaries, provides power and thermal management solutions in Mainland China, the United States, Taiwan, Thailand, and internationally. It operates through Power Electronics, Mobility, Automation, and Infrastructure segments. The company offers inductors, transformer components, networking products, EMI filters, solenoids, current sensing resistors, power modules, and stamping and over molding components; embedded power, adapters, industrial and medical power solutions, industrial battery charging, USB socket outlets, and hydrogen power and high voltage power solutions; and DC brushless and EC fans and blowers, automotive thermal and thermal management solutions, liquid cooling and climate thermal solutions, and indoor air quality products. It also provides EV power electronics, traction, and X-in-1 products. In addition, the company offers drive and power quality, motion, control, robot, and manufacturing equipment, as well as field devices, software, and industrial PCs; and building management and control, indoor air quality, LED lighting, smart surveillance, healthy lighting, and building solutions. Further, it provides telecom power systems, networking and rural electrification system, UPS and data center infrastructure, and power quality products; EV charging, energy storage systems, photovoltaic inverters, energy management, wind power converters, solid state transformers, medium voltage drives, high voltage power, automatic test equipment, and hydrogen energy and fuel cell solutions; and business and education multimedia and high-performance projectors, collaboration and signage solutions, and smart campus solutions, as well as DLP, LED, and LCD video walls. Additionally, it provides consulting services for building management and control solutions. Delta Electronics, Inc. was founded in 1971 and is headquartered in Taipei, Taiwan.
